Where to Use It Carefully

While the Poinsettia Greenhouse Card Christmas SVG is a strong visual, there are some scenarios where you might want to tread carefully. For instance, using it on stretchy fabrics like knits or jerseys could lead to distortion unless you adjust the stitch types and add stabilizer. Similarly, thin or textured materials may not support the density of stitches required to maintain the 3D effect.

If you plan to embroider this on a curved surface like a cap or hat, consider breaking the design down or using specialized tools to compensate for the curvature. Also, watch out for dense stitch areas that might cause puckering, especially on delicate or frequently washed items like baby clothes or tea towels. In these cases, test the design thoroughly before committing to production.
